A school has two varsity basketball teams. One is the girls' team, and the other is the boys' team. On any given Saturday in Dec

ember, the probability that the girls' team will have a game is 0.8, and the probability that the boys' team will have a game is 0.7. The probability that both teams have games is 0.65.
On any given Saturday in December, what is the probability that either the girls' team or the boys' team has a game?
Answer choices:
0.65
0.7
0.8
0.85

The probability that either the girls' or boys' team gets a game is 0.85            

Step-by-step explanation:

Step 1:

Let P(G) represent the probability of girls team getting a game and P(B) represent the probability of the boys team getting a game.

P(B ∪ G) represents the probability of either girls and boys team getting a game.

P(B ∩ G) represents the probability of both girls and boys team getting a game.

Step 2:

It is given that P(G) = 0.8, P(B) = 0.7 and P(B ∩ G) = 0.65

We need to find the probability of either girls or boys team getting a game which is represented by P(B ∪ G)

Step 3:

P(B ∪ G) = P(B) + P(G) - P(B ∩ G)

= 0.8 + 0.7 - 0.65 = 0.85

Step 4:

Answer:

The probability that either the girls' or boys' team gets a game is 0.85

How many ways can 5 people be arranged in a line?
Rasek [7]

Answer: 120 ways

Step-by-step explanation: In this problem, we're asked how many ways can 5 people be arranged in a line.

Let's start by drawing 5 blanks to represent the 5 different positions in the line.

Now, we know that 5 different people can fill the spot in the first position. However, once the first position is filled, only 4 people can fill the second spot and once the second spot is filled, only 3 people can fill the third spot and so on. So we have <u>5</u> <u>4</u> <u>3</u> <u>2</u> <u>1</u>.

Now, based on the counting principle, there are 5 x 4 x 3 x 2 x 1 ways for all 5 spots to be filled.

5 x 4 is 20, 20 x 3 is 60, 60 x 2 is 120, and 120 x 1 is 120.

So there are 120 ways for all 5 spots to be filled which means that there are 120 ways that 5 people can be arranged in a line.
